500 Gallon LOX Trailers

Essex Industries recently received an order from the United States Air Force for 500 Gallon LOX Trailers. Shipment of the 32 trailers was scheduled to begin in August and run through February of 2018. The USAF will deploy most of these units at domestic bases, as well as US bases in Oman, Japan, South Korea and Italy.
The Essex 500 Gallon LOX Trailer is a mobile liquid oxygen storage tank assembly. Designed for the transport and storage of LOX at airbases and military installations, the 500 Gallon LOX Trailer provides a logistics solution for flight line LOX requirements. Liquid Oxygen is used for aircraft pilot and crew life support applications, allowing them to breath oxygen at altitudes in which oxygen is less prevalent. Liquid oxygen is also used for casualty evacuation applications allowing patients and warfighters who are in critical condition access to the mass amounts of oxygen required to stabilize their SpO2, or blood oxygen saturation level.
Storing oxygen in a liquid form allows for the Air Force, amongst many other users, to mobilize enormous amounts of oxygen without compromising the already limited space and weight allowances on board aircraft. It also stores oxygen at a significantly lower pressure than gaseous oxygen systems which provides a safety benefit for system maintainers, operators, and users.
The 500 Gallon LOX Trailer can be used with all Essex LOX converters, BMOS, BMOS-FS, MMOS, NPTLOX, PTLOX and 50 Gallon LOX Carts. A 500 Gallon LIN Trailer for the transport and storage of liquid nitrogen is also available. Both 500 Gallon Trailers are qualified to Air Force PD13WRGRVEA05 and environmentally tested to MIL-STD-810.
